Within the ancient Fortress, the Tower of London, visitors can gaze up at the imposing White Tower, tiptoe through a king’s medieval bedchamber and marvel at the priceless Crown Jewels. Hear bloody tales of the Tower told by the Yeoman Warders; stand where famous heads rolled and discover where prisoners and exotic animals including a polar bear were kept.

Buy tickets at the kiosk outside the Tower of London instead. By purchasing this, you are only buying tickets that are available at the kiosk right outside the Tower of London. The prices would have been lower for our kids if we had bought tickets at the kiosk. You need to wait in line at the kiosk even if you purchase the tickets here- they don’t email you the tickets and they are not available on Ticketmaster. So we ended up waiting in line at the kiosk to collect our more expensive tickets than the tickets we could have purchased once we got to the front of the line. Also, the tour advertised here is a tour available to all ticket holders. The tours with the beefeaters start every 30 minutes at the Tower of London. I definitely recommend going to the Tower of London, but just buy the tickets there. They don’t seem to limit the number of tickets, our tour group had maybe 50+ people in it. The line for the Crown Jewels is super long. If you want to see the Crown Jewels, I would recommend entering early and heading straight inside to the building that holds the Crown Jewels. The have turnstiles outside it (like at Disneyland) and the line overflowed the turnstiles and was too long - we didn’t want to wait in that in the rain, although many people did wait. Overall, we highly recommend the Tower of London, but there doesn’t seem to be a benefit of buying the tickets here.
